Table 3G (continued from previous page) Troubleshooting Chart - Fault Messages Displayed on Boiler Interface

FAULT

DESCRIPTION

CORRECTIVE ACTION

Fan Speed Low 1

(will require a manual

reset once the condition

has been corrected. Press

the RESET button on the
SMART TOUCH

display

to reset.)

The actual fan 1 RPM is 30% lower than
what is being called for.

• Vent/air intake lengths exceed the maximum allowed
lengths. Refer to Section 2 - General Venting of the
Crest Installation and Operation Manual for
proper lengths.
• Check for obstruction or blockage in the vent/air
intake pipes or at terminations.
• Check the wiring connections at fan 1 and at the
main control board.
• Replace the fan.

Blown fuse.

• Replace fuse F2 on the control board, see page 36
of this manual.
